Publisher's summary

Mark is a doctor at St. Vincent’s, determined to be the best on the floor. While his passion lies in saving those who need his help, he’s distracted by another physician at the hospital. They may see each other every day, but Mark wants more than a nod in passing.

Jason is Mark’s rival, a talented medic in his own right and a fiery romantic. While the man he has his eye on is a little more aloof, Jason wants to pounce and dig his claws in. It's just too bad that he can't find the time outside work.

Together, the two doctors find that they make each other shine. Life couldn’t be better when the two find a connection so true. But when problems arise and Mark’s fate is left in the hands of a coworker with a side of jealousy, will Mark and Jason lose each other?

Dr. Perfect is a gay stand-alone romance audiobook intended for adults only.

Such An Enjoyable Story

Mark and Jason just draw you in . The characters are so wonderful, that you can’t help rooting for them to make it work.Family and societal pressures are very powerful. Mark clearly has feelings for Jason. Jason thinks Mark is straight. It takes a threat to Jason’s future yo bring Mark out of the closet and allow him to fight for Jason and a future with him. Peter does a wonderful job of fleshing out his characters and letting us truly get to know them. Life can be complicated. It can make getting things we want, harder than we would like. Gabriel’s narration adds depth to the characters. I would recommend this book to anyone who loves a happy ending.

Falling for a Co-worker

Dr. Perfect is a tale of two resident physicians. They work well together, a d make an excellent team.

A supervising doctor chooses to favor one doctor over the other based on social values. The story is fiction, but the situations can happen in a lot of workplaces.

The residents doctors find that not only
do they make a great work team, they also would make great relationship pair... if only other people's expectations would quit getting in the way!

Narrator Gabriel Amari is new to me. His voice and pacing makes for easy listening, and exciting, fearful, distressed moments feel realistic. The HEA was delightful.
